Check out this podcast episode with #freshoffthevote on SELF-CARE! Description: We're living through a global pandemic, civil unrest, and threats to our democracy. It's necessary for young people to step up in advocating for a better future. But in doing so, we often don’t realize the stress and anxiety that can take a toll on our bodies. How can you take better care of yourself? Especially when it feels like people may not be understanding? Or that self-care is expensive and... inaccessible? In this episode, #FOTV hosts Amy and Kaitlyn speak with two professors about the history and relevance of radical self-care. Dr. Donna Nicol is an associate professor and chair of the Africana Studies Department at Cal State Dominguez Hills. Dr. Jennifer A. Yee is a Professor of Asian American Studies at California State University, Fullerton (CSUF). What is radical about radical self-care and how is it different from good old consumerism? #FOTV also brings in Jess Ayden Li, an activist & nonprofit consultant for how she helps organizations implement self-care cultures. Statement of Support The Department of Asian American Studies strongly supports and amplifies the Department of African American Studies and their Letter of Support to Our Students. We stand with our colleagues in our collective opposition to racism and the violence it perpetuates in all of our communities. We believe it is crucial for Asian, Pacific Islander and Desi American (APIDA) communities to share this message of solidarity with Black communities and call for an end t...o systemic and systematic violent racism. Like the fight against anti-Black racism, our fight against anti-APIDA racism, especially in these pandemic times focuses on eliminating the blight of white supremacy. We urge our APIDA communities to fight racism on campus, locally, and globally. We urge all as individuals and collectively to stand up and take action for community, equity, justice, and peace. ===== Eric Estuar Reyes, Ph.D. Associate Professor of Asian American Studies California State University at Fullerton

Sat., Feb. 1 and Sat., Feb. 8, 10-2 pm, includes lunch by The Cambodian Family (a collective addressing mental health through the arts) located in Santa Ana. This year, they are offering a creative writing workshop over two sessions including lunch. Participants may be of any age and background. A professional creative writing facilitator will lead workshops to create a positive process for well-being in our communities through the creation of poetry, memoir, and short stories.
